Remembrance Day panic caused by ‘known tramp’

A tramp well-known in the centre of Amsterdam caused the panic which disrupted Tuesday evening’s Remembrance Day commemorations, the Telegraaf reports on Thursday.


The man is known as Adam and has made the Spui street which runs from the Dam his home for the past 18 months, the paper says, quoting local bar staff.
The man, dressed in a long black coat, caused a stampede when he began shouting during the two minutes silence. He will appear in court on Friday charged with disturbing the peace and causing physical injury.
